This week's Shabby Tea Room inspiration photo got me thinking about making another little box similar to the one under the table in this photo.! Isn't this a wonderful shabby chic scene?! I don't decorate my home in this style - but I do love looking at it!

I started with a little oval wood chipboard box 3 1/4" x 4 1/4" and covered it with patterned paper that had been sponged with Tea Dye Ink (of course!) I made my cluster of roses using red felt - you can see how I made these on my post here. I painted and sparkled a grungeboard scrolly and tucked it under the sentiment panel - to mimic the white leg on the table in the photo.

The sentiment and frame are Waltzingmouse.

I even made a handle for my little box. I punched a hole on each end with my Cropadile and threaded a piece of hemp twine through the holes knotting the ends on the inside. This is actually long enough to pull up and use to carry this little box!

The dress hanging on the wall in the photo also inspired me. I have a wonderful stamp by Serendipity that is 3 beautiful vintage dresses hanging on a line. I inked just one of them for my card and added some flower soft at the bust and hem to give the feeling of the chennille in the picture.
I used my Scor Pal to make lines like the tile floor in the picture. I made this flower out of Mulberry paper. I stamped the dress on pink flowery paper, cut it out and layered it over the 'wallpaper'. The frame is Spellbinders and is popped up on foam dimensionals as is the dress.
